For this latest limited release our brewers pushed the boat out by brewing an amber saison with a difference. The beer is the result of several fermentations across a different number of ex-pinot noir barrels. After fermentation the beers were then blended together to achieve the desired flavour profile. The beers were all fermented with different microbes: traditional saison yeast, two strains of Lactocacillus bacteria and two strains of brettanomyces, a wild yeast that is known for its unusual flavour contributions to some styles of Belgian beer. The brewer’s blend marries all of the different components to produce a beer that displays a tart fruitiness with distinct spice and funk from the wild yeasts. Little Red Riding Wood is a saison-based beer and as such finishes bone dry with a touch of oak tannin.
